Cyrus Spitama
E1053838
UNEXPLORED
Cyrus Spitama is the fictional Zoroastrian diplomat and narrator of Gore Vidal’s historical novel "Creation," through whose travels and encounters with major ancient philosophers and leaders the story explores competing religious and philosophical ideas of the classical world.
